English Notes Chapter 2.5 – A Heroine of the Sea Class 8 Maharashtra Board

Notes For All Chapters – English Class 8

1. Introduction

  • The story is about Grace Darling, a brave young woman who risked her life to save shipwrecked passengers.
  • It is set in 1838 on the rocky coast of England, where Grace lived with her parents in the Longstone Lighthouse.
  • The lighthouse played a crucial role in guiding ships and preventing accidents at sea.

2. Grace Darling and Her Life

Early Life:

  • Grace was the daughter of a lighthouse keeper, William Darling.
  • She lived in lonely lighthouses far away from towns and cities.
  • Her father was well-educated and taught his children to read, write, and be honest, brave, and selfless.
  • Grace was small in height but strong in willpower and courage.

Life in the Lighthouse:

  • The lighthouse was located on wild islands near the east coast of England.
  • Life in the lighthouse was tough, with strong winds, storms, and isolation.
  • Grace stayed back with her parents while her siblings left for jobs in the cities.

3. The Night of the Shipwreck (6th September 1838)

  • A terrible storm struck at night, causing a ship named Forfarshire to crash onto the rocks.
  • Most passengers drowned, but nine people managed to cling to a rock.
  • The lighthouse’s noise and distance prevented Grace and her family from hearing their cries for help.

4. Grace’s Brave Decision

  • The next morning at 6 AM, Grace saw people clinging to the rocks.
  • She urged her father to rescue the survivors, but he hesitated as the storm was dangerous.
  • Her mother, Mrs. Darling, discouraged them, fearing they would drown too.
  • Grace convinced her father, saying she was strong enough to row the boat.

5. The Rescue Mission

Grace and her father rowed through enormous waves to reach the survivors.

The boat rocked violently, and the journey was extremely risky.

When they reached the rock:

  • William Darling jumped onto the rock to help.
  • Grace held the boat steady and pulled in two sailors.
  • The sailors helped row back to the lighthouse with some survivors.

Her father and the sailors returned to rescue the remaining four men.


6. After the Rescue

  • Grace and her mother took care of the survivors, giving them food and warmth.
  • The rescued passengers later told newspapers about Grace’s bravery.
  • Grace and her father became famous across England.
  • Funds were raised to support lighthouse keepers.

7. Grace Darling’s Legacy

  • Recognition: Grace and her father received awards and appreciation for their heroism.
  • Tragic End: Grace died young at 27 years old, but her bravery is still remembered.
  • She became an inspiration for courage and selflessness.

8. Themes and Moral Lessons

  1. Courage and Determination – Grace showed immense bravery despite the dangers.
  2. Selflessness – She risked her own life to save others.
  3. Importance of Family Support – Her father supported her decision, showing the strength of family bonds.
  4. Helping Others in Need – We should always help people in distress.
  5. Women’s Strength – The story proves that women are as strong and capable as men.

9. Important Vocabulary from the Chapter

  • Lighthouse – A tall tower with a bright light that guides ships.
  • Shipwreck – The destruction of a ship at sea.
  • Rescue – To save someone from danger.
  • Clinging – Holding on tightly.
  • Oars – Poles used for rowing a boat.
  • Set off – To begin a journey.

10. Conclusion

  • Grace Darling is a true heroine who proved that even a small person can do great things.
  • Her story teaches us bravery, kindness, and the importance of helping others.
  • Even today, she is remembered as an inspiration for courage and selflessness.
